			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>The atmosphere was perfect; A nice cool late summer evening, a small aging venue, minimal lighting and a packed crowd rising and falling with the music. </p>
<p>I have listened to <a href="http://www.explosionsinthesky.com/">Explosions in the Sky</a> a few times but do not own any of their records or never really got into their music. I knew they were an esoteric band that played long format songs full of ambience, noise and raw rock power but I had no idea of the pleasant surprise I was in for. I had the chance to see them live, took the opportunity and WOW, I was blown away! What a great band to see live! They are now up near the top of my <em>&#8216;must see them live&#8217;</em> list along with <a href="http://www.sonicyouth.com/">Sonic Youth</a> and <a href="http://www.arcadefire.com/">The Arcade Fire</a> as far an having a great stage presence and creating a performance that feels so organic and alive, it gives me chills.</p>
<p>I love the fact that their music is all instrumental leaving the feeling and interpretation completely up to the listener. In today&#8217;s pop song and short attention span world it&#8217;s wonderful to see that a band like this can sell out a show in Louisville, KY. If you have a chance to get out and see Explosions in the Sky, please do, you will not regret it! After their set there was no encore! I thought that was amazing. Everybody plays an encore these days, it&#8217;s expected, but at the end of the set they waved goodbye and then came back out 5 minutes later to inform us, yes they were really done and said something to the effect of they were drained from the performance and hope we enjoyed it, but that&#8217;s it. respect.</p>
